由于centos7原本就安装了Python2,而且这个Python2不能被删除,因为有很多系统命令,比如yum都要用到。

[root@VM_105_217_centos Python-3.6.2]# python
Python 2.7.5 (default, Aug  4 2017, 00:39:18)
[GCC 4.8.5 20150623 (Red Hat 4.8.5-16)] on linux2
Type "help", "copyright", "credits" or "license" for more information.

输入Python命令,查看可以得知是Python2.7.5版本

输入

which python

可以查看位置,一般是位于/usr/bin/python目录下。

下面介绍安装Python3的方法

首先安装依赖包

yum -y groupinstall "Development tools"
y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el

然后根据自己需求下载不同版本的Python3,我下载的是Python3.6.2

wget https://www.python.org/ftp/python/3.6.2/Python-3.6.2.tar.xz

如果速度不够快,可以直接去官网下载,利用WinSCP等软件传到服务器上指定位置,我的存放目录是/usr/local/python3,使用命令:

mkdir /usr/local/python3 

建立一个空文件夹

然后解压压缩包,进入该目录,安装Python3

tar -xvJf  Python-3.6.2.tar.xz
cd Python-3.6.2
./configure --prefix=/usr/local/python3
make && make install

最后创建软链接

ln -s /usr/local/python3/bin/python3 /usr/bin/python3
ln -s /usr/local/python3/bin/pip3 /usr/bin/pip3

在命令行中输入python3测试

Linux系统下Python3的安装相关推荐

  1. linux的软件包是独立的,Linux系统下软件包的安装

    (以下内容是云课堂Linux课程的笔记,个人纯手工记录,课程以RedHat系列为主) Linux系统下软件包的安装方式包括:源代码安装.本地二进制包安装(rpm命令手工安装).在线二进制包安装(yum ...

  2. linux系统下源码安装mysql5.6数据库

    linux系统下源码安装mysql5.6数据库 下载mysql数据库相关软件包(百度云盘:http://pan.baidu.com/s/1bnL31c7) 从mysql 5.5版本开始,mysql源码 ...

  3. Linux系统下adb驱动安装步骤 及 问题总结

    Linux系统下adb驱动安装步骤 及 问题总结 一.安装ADB工具 sudo apt-get update sudo apt-get install android-tools-adb 二.adb驱 ...

  4. LINUX系统下ORACLE19C客户端安装步骤

    LINUX系统下ORACLE19C客户端安装步骤 服务器系统版本:CentOS 7.4 Oracle客户端安装包(19C版本)下载地址: Instant Client for Linux x86-64 ...

  5. Linux系统下禅道的安装以及配置教程

    Linux系统下禅道的安装以及配置教程 首先查看Linux安装的版本,64的还是32的! 查看Linux版本:[root@localhost ~]# getconf LONG_BIT 1.Linux中 ...

  6. Win或Linux系统下用conda安装Open Babel

    一.安装Anaconda或Miniconda Win或者Linux系统下Anaconda或Miniconda安装,不赘述,网上很多教程. 二.利用conda安装openbabel install -c ...

  7. Windows和Linux系统下,虚拟环境安装的全面说明和详细步骤

    虚拟环境的创建和使用 用途: ​ 1.在同一台电脑安装同一个包的不同版本 2.记录项目所用的所有的包的版本,方便部署. 如何使用: 1.创建虚拟环境 mkvirtualenv 虚拟环境名 -p pyt ...

  8. 爱快固件是Linux系统吗,Linux 系统下 VirtualBox 里安装爱快系统 (2.4.4)

    9 z; x$ t+ p) L% R$ K* ` 来论坛几个月了一直也没奉献点啥, 今天下午想在 VirtualBox 里安装个软路由系统体验一下, 于是就想索性就写成一篇帖子分享给大家吧. 之所以装 ...

  9. Linux系统下指定应用安装目录时提示 ./configure报-bash: ./configure: No such file or directory

    我们Linux系统在安装应用程序时进行指定其安装目录 ,通常使用  ./configure  --prefix=自定义的安装目录 命令来操作. 例如我安装python应用使用    ./configu ...

最新文章

  1. 一键数据分析自动化特征工程!
  2. R语言临床预测模型的评价指标与验证指标实战:净重新分类指数NRI(Net Reclassification Index, NRI)
  3. pythonsql注入步骤_防止SQL注入解决方案
  4. 打造自己的分布式搜索引擎底层架构(非Lucene)
  5. 虚拟机和linux系统整理??
  6. 思科路由器与windows建立L2L ipsec×××
  7. Pascal VOC Dataset 下载地址
  8. GMS地下水数值模拟
  9. pythonnumpy安装教程_windows 下python+numpy安装实用教程
  10. 工具类-BasePopupWindow
  11. 最燃黑客情报官薛锋:端起AK伏特加,代表人民把坏人抓
  12. MAC 常用终端命令
  13. 光猫路由器与交换机的连接方式
  14. autoconf使用
  15. ActionBarTest、FragmentTest
  16. 线程池的shutdown()与shutdownNow()方法的区别
  17. C#中this与base的区别
  18. 榆熙电商:如何保证店铺头像和风格的统一?
  19. python自动化开发实战实战2:用列表与文件创建购物系统
  20. Ubuntu系统---FeiQ安装记录

热门文章

  1. matlab 连续两个if,求大神解答一个matlab中的for循环嵌套if选择语句
  2. Glide 4.9源码解析-图片加载流程
  3. 字段是什么意思,ocpp文档里的FIELD(字段)
  4. Java身份证信息查看
  5. 徐有高【TTG多玩自购】PS3《英雄传说 闪之轨迹》
  6. 聚类方法(思维导图)
  7. 很多的梦在等待着进行
  8. 520来了,用数据告诉你应该买什么礼物
  9. 中国歌剧舞剧院胡晓丹_向歌剧致敬
  10. xilinx axi详解